qnblackcat / uYouPlus

uYou+ is a modified version of uYou (made by @MiRO92) with additional features and mainly made for non jailbroken users!
7.17k stars 8.24k forks source link

1080p Premium not available? (Iā€™m YT Premium member) #1312

Open KarmaBeast opened 6 months ago

KarmaBeast commented 6 months ago

Have you read the FAQ?

Is there an existing issue/question for this?

Do you think this is a bug?

āœ… Yes, I believe this is a bug. I will open a new issue with the bug template

My question

Im paying for YT premium. On my Android with Revanced Extented(and iOS stock YT) I can still play 1080p Premium. As you can see in this screenshot: IMG_1643

But the same video on uyou+ is not available in 1080p Premium: IMG_1644

Video link: https://youtu.be/gadinpHHjWU?si=CzjbPd679M_B16Zh

Additional context

No response

KarmaBeast commented 6 months ago

Aa far as I remember, ios doesn't have a separate high bit rate option.

Cause I read somewhere that the only "free/hack" way to enable this feature on other platform is to set your youtube client as ios.

I may be worng on this.

What that hell are you even on about? I had this feature with the stock YT on my iPhone. It became first available on iOS only before any other device.

qnblackcat commented 6 months ago

I'm a YouTube Premium user, too. I can see 1080p Premium on my main phone, but not the others. Strange...

IMG_C0B3697B7A04-1

KarmaBeast commented 6 months ago

The fact that it shows you the 1080p Premium option but not me is strange enough. I just don't get it, and it's a big deal to me. 1080p Premium is important to me šŸ˜”

PoomSmart commented 6 months ago

There are A/B flags related to premium quality, try looking for and playing around something with "hbr" + "premium" + "playbackCap".

KarmaBeast commented 6 months ago

There are A/B flags related to premium quality, try looking for and playing around something with "hbr" + "premium" + "playbackCap".

I will try those out. But why would I need to mess around with AB flags when this feature is available by default in the stock app and modded apps on Android (Revanced Extented)

In the AppStore app I have it available, but the second I try any uyou apps it's unavailable.

KarmaBeast commented 6 months ago

Still not available šŸ˜”

PoomSmart commented 6 months ago

YTHotConfig.premiumClientSharedConfigEnablePremiumHbrPlaybackCap should be enabled.

KarmaBeast commented 6 months ago

YTHotConfig.premiumClientSharedConfigEnablePremiumHbrPlaybackCap should be enabled.

First of all I have that already enabled, but double checked anyway. Secondly why would we need to depend on AB flags so that we could use features that way pay for? (YouTube Premium member)

On all stock YT apps be it on the AppStore or Googles Playstore on Android, and modded YT apps such as Revanced Extented this feature is available to me by default. Cuz I pay for YouTube Premium. It's still only missing in all uyouplus, uyouenhanced apps šŸ˜”

ā€“ Same issue with the Dynamic Island: https://github.com/qnblackcat/uYouPlus/issues/1309 I believe the uyou client is spoofing YouTube Premium to enable background playback. And because uyou apps are not optimized for iPhone 14 Pro (Max) Dynamic Island feature it conflicts with the Dynamic Island and activates it while in-app and when exiting the app(PiP). I have disabled the 'No ads' and all 'Background playback' tweaks but it's still showing the Dynamic Island. This never happens with the stock YT app. It's really annoying.

PoomSmart commented 6 months ago

"Why would we depend on AB flags?"

Simply put, it's YouTube you are talking about. They can turn on or off any flags depending on what YouTube client you actually use - even with the spoofing where we may miss something or when we are on the sideloaded version with missing entitlements. Not something we can control. ĀÆ_(惄)_/ĀÆ

KarmaBeast commented 6 months ago

Ok which flag is it? I tried all of those you mentioned.